WBTC has been working with local employers to help their business flourish and grow since 1983. We're not for profit which lets us to take an imaginative approach in supporting our customers.
It's a popular choice for employers to bring young people into the organisation and train them up. Apprentices can be moulded to suit your culture and they often have a strong learning behaviour enabling them to pick up new skills quickly. WBTC will help you by; carefully matching apprentices to your organisation. accessing any grants for you to cover the initial costs of employing an apprentice, organise all of the training/assessment, sort the government funding, provide someone in your organisation with a mentoring course, take care of any paperwork.
